Crystal Tears

Every night she prayed for something To make a change in her life Knowing when he came home again He would claim her as his wife She had to do as he wanted Never dared to refuse Knowing that would only get her Another painful bruise Her silent tears fell like crystals From a broken chandelier She screamed, but only in her mind So he could never hear Those terrible years ended for her When he was driving like a fool He was so drunk he missed his turn And drowned in the neighbor's pool That night: Her joyful tears sparkled like crystals On a golden chandelier She laughed out loud, not caring If the whole, wide world could hear.
